Default Server overload in progress

As regular members have probably noticed, the Techwatch forums are suffering problems due to the heavy load the huge influx of cable users are causing.

Techwatch is running on a powerful server, but in an attempt to help reduce the stress on the server I'm going to try moving some of the other sites onto another server.

Hopefully that's going to help, but I've got the sys admins at the datacenter keeping a continuous eye on the server and hopefully we'll be able to mostly keep on top of this issue.
